Prepare the Fish
Rinse 1 pound of white fish fillets under cold water, then pat dry with paper towels. Cut into serving-size pieces.
- 5
Set Up Breading Station
In one bowl, place 1 cup of flour. In a second bowl, whisk together 2 large eggs. In a third bowl, combine 1 cup of cornmeal, 1 teaspoon of salt, 1 teaspoon of black pepper, 1 teaspoon of paprika, and 1 teaspoon of cayenne pepper.

Heat the Oil
In a deep skillet or fryer, heat 2 cups of oil over medium-high heat until it reaches 350°F (175°C).
- 8
Fry the Fish
Carefully place the breaded fish into the hot oil, frying in batches if necessary. Fry for about 3-4 minutes per side, or until golden brown and cooked through. Remove and drain on paper towels.
Assembly
- 9
Plate the Dish
Spoon a generous portion of the smoked gouda grits onto each plate. Top with the fried fish.
- 10
Garnish and Serve
Garnish with lemon wedges and chopped fresh parsley before serving.
